Clients in order to be aware that different rules apply once the IRS has now placed a tax lien against them. A bankruptcy may relieve you of personal liability on a tax debt, but in some circumstances won't discharge a nicely filed tax lien. After bankruptcy, the irs cannot chase you personally for the debt, nevertheless the lien stay on any assets so you will not able to sell these assets without satisfying the outstanding lien.
